Thunderbolts

A group of complex characters, including Yelena Belova, Bucky Barnes, and others, each with their own dark pasts and troubled histories, are brought together by circumstance. They’re trapped and forced to work together to survive, but their differences and conflicting motivations threaten to tear them apart. 

As they navigate their perilous mission, they’ll have to confront their inner demons and learn to trust each other if they hope to make it out alive. But with their complicated histories and conflicting goals, can they form a strong enough alliance to survive? Thunderbolt will be in theaters from May 2nd.

Lilo & Stitch

movies in May 2025

On the exotic planet Turo, the brilliant but mad scientist, Dr. Jumba Jookiba, faces exile for his illegal creation, Experiment 626. This nearly invincible creature escapes and crash-lands on Earth, finding himself in the care of the young and troubled Lilo.

As Jumba and Agent Pleakley are sent to recapture 626, now known as Stitch, chaos ensues, threatening Lilo’s family. But when Lilo is kidnapped, Stitch must choose between his destructive nature and the newfound meaning of ‘ohana,’ leading to a showdown that will determine the fate of a little girl and a creature from another world. Coming to theaters on May 23!

Clown in the Cornfield 

Seeking a new beginning, Quinn and her father relocate to the seemingly tranquil town of Kettle Springs. However, they quickly discover the town is reeling from the loss of its main employer, a factory destroyed by fire, leaving the community divided and resentful. 

As local disputes escalate, a menacing clown with a disturbing grin materializes from the surrounding cornfields, embarking on a gruesome campaign to “purify” the town, leaving a trail of bloody carnage in its wake. Catch the clown in the theaters on May 9!

Final Destination: Bloodlines

movies in May 2025

In one of the most anticipated movies in May 2025, a teenage girl is plagued by recurring nightmares of a 1960s tower collapse, a chilling inheritance from her grandmother’s precognitive visions. 

The grandmother once used this gift to save lives, but now, the granddaughter’s visions foretell the deaths of her own family. She must confront this deadly legacy and break the sequence before Death claims them all. Millenials all over the world are definitely holding their breaths for this one! Check it out on May 16!

Bring Her Back

A24 has released the first trailer for ‘Bring Her Back,’ the second film from Danny and Michael Philippou (directors of ‘Talk to Me’). The horror film, set for release in theaters on May 30th centers on siblings who discover a disturbing ritual at their foster mother’s isolated home. 

The movie stars Sally Hawkins, Billy Barratt, Sora Wong, and Jonah Wren Phillips. The Philippou Brothers directed this from a script co-written by Danny Philippou and Bill Hinzman.
